The episode introduces (played by Nakama Yukie), a 23-year-old idealistic teacher hired to teach mathematics at Shirokin High, an all-boys school. To her shock, she is assigned to Class 3-D , the school's most notorious group of delinquents. Gokusen Dorama Season 1 - My review - sunakoyue Yes, the sweet woman bowing to her students
The premiere of Season 1, titled "Arrival of the Rookie Teacher with a Secret!!", aired on April 17, 2002, in Japan (and later dubbed in January 2004 for international audiences).
